Improving models to predict holocellulose and klason lignin contents for peat soil organic matter with mid-infrared spectra

HIGHLIGHTS

  • who: SOIL et al. from the University of Mu00fcnster, Heisenbergstr2, Mu00fcnster, Germany have published the research: Improving models to predict holocellulose and Klason lignin contents for peat soil organic matter with mid-infrared spectra, in the Journal: (JOURNAL) of 11/Nov/2022
  • what: This study provides a validation with the aim to identify concrete steps to improve these models. As a first step the authors provide several improvements using the original training data.
